Jehangir Art Gallery was founded in 1952 by Sir Cowasji Jehangir, a prominent businessman and art patron. He envisioned a space dedicated to promoting and showcasing Indian art. The gallery quickly became a hub for artists from all over the country, fostering a dynamic exchange of ideas and styles. Over the decades, it has hosted exhibitions by some of India's most celebrated artists, including M.F. Husain, S.H. Raza, and F.N. Souza. The gallery's enduring popularity is a testament to its significant contribution to the Indian art scene.
